Henry is an avid reader.He devours 90 pages in half-an-hour.How many pages has Henry read per minute?

Answer:

3 pages per minute

Step-by-step explanation:

Half an hour is eqquivalent to 30 minutes, so we do 90 (pages) / 30 (minutes) = 3--> Wich means that Henry can read 3 pages per minute.
